網(wǎng)站前端SEO代碼及標(biāo)簽的優(yōu)化

網(wǎng)站優(yōu)化結(jié)構(gòu)布局要求盡量往簡單優(yōu)化,提倡扁平化結(jié)構(gòu)。所以代碼優(yōu)化是SEO內(nèi)部優(yōu)化一個重要部分,不然發(fā)個外鏈、寫個文章,是個人基本都能夠做到的,為了跟上SEO的步伐,學(xué)代碼懂前端,甚至獨立搭建網(wǎng)站是SEOER必需經(jīng)過的一段路程!網(wǎng)站建設(shè)★網(wǎng)站設(shè)計★網(wǎng)站制作★網(wǎng)頁設(shè)計-800元全包;企業(yè)網(wǎng)絡(luò)推廣☆網(wǎng)站優(yōu)化☆seo☆關(guān)鍵詞排名☆百度快照-2200元全年展示;做網(wǎng)站優(yōu)化排名-網(wǎng)站建設(shè)公司

成都創(chuàng)新互聯(lián)公司專業(yè)為企業(yè)提供眉縣網(wǎng)站建設(shè)、眉縣做網(wǎng)站、眉縣網(wǎng)站設(shè)計、眉縣網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計與制作、眉縣企業(yè)網(wǎng)站模板建站服務(wù),10多年眉縣做網(wǎng)站經(jīng)驗,不只是建網(wǎng)站,更提供有價值的思路和整體網(wǎng)絡(luò)服務(wù)。

這也是為什么我把seoer分為三個階段原因,我一直認(rèn)為seoer有三個階段這里簡單的說下:

第一個階段

就是目前seo行業(yè)內(nèi)最多的一部分人,他們只有一些seo基礎(chǔ),甚至專業(yè)知識都不是太會,而seo學(xué)了足夠的專業(yè)知識也沒能突破第一個階段。他們只有seo的相關(guān)知識。

第二個階段

是目前業(yè)內(nèi)存在很少的一部分人,這部分人會seo知識同時也具備了一定的代碼知識,也就是html。

第三個階段

可以說業(yè)內(nèi)所存在的更少,這部分人已經(jīng)不止與seo,代碼知識,他們還需要懂編程。只有這部分人才能真正的把seo做好。

做網(wǎng)站優(yōu)化最開始部分就是要做好我們網(wǎng)站的前端seo。做SEO優(yōu)化的基礎(chǔ)也是做好前端的SEO優(yōu)化。

所以說前端代碼優(yōu)化尤為重要,通過網(wǎng)站的結(jié)構(gòu)布局設(shè)計和網(wǎng)頁代碼優(yōu)化,使前端頁面既能讓瀏覽器用戶能夠看懂,也能讓“蜘蛛”看懂。

網(wǎng)站前端SEO代碼及標(biāo)簽的優(yōu)化

一、DIV+CSS

DIV+CSS的網(wǎng)站結(jié)構(gòu)對SEO優(yōu)化起到的作用越來越明顯。

其只要原因有一下幾個方面

1、采用這種結(jié)構(gòu)后,html頁面里基本只有文字或圖片信息,而樣式則放在css里,這樣搜索引擎蜘蛛就不會管css,只采集html里的內(nèi)容就可以大大提高搜索引擎蜘蛛的效率。

2、采用這種結(jié)構(gòu)往往關(guān)鍵詞更集中,密度更高。

3、div+css 行對于table來說比較精簡,基本不存在表格嵌套的問題。

4、符合W3C標(biāo)準(zhǔn)的網(wǎng)頁在SEO優(yōu)化方面本身就是優(yōu)勢,更得到搜索引擎蜘蛛的喜愛。

二、Meta標(biāo)簽

Meta標(biāo)簽:如果要做的非常簡單,meta標(biāo)簽只需要設(shè)置一個字符編碼就可以了,咱們在任意地方購買的模版都會寫上字符編碼,另外Title標(biāo)題、關(guān)鍵詞、Description描述這里也列為meta標(biāo)簽去優(yōu)化,這三個地方,一般在模版中會直接調(diào)用到后臺,可以直接在后臺設(shè)置,所以代碼上需要基本是不需要操作。

網(wǎng)站前端SEO代碼及標(biāo)簽的優(yōu)化

三、css/js引用

搜索引擎蜘蛛處理的是文本文件,對頁面源代碼中沒有出現(xiàn)的內(nèi)容則看不到,用戶的行為或者其他事件之后才獲取并嵌入頁面上的動態(tài)內(nèi)容和連接不能被搜索引擎看到,網(wǎng)頁中大量的javascript 將影響蜘蛛對頁面的抓取和增加網(wǎng)頁體積,會延遲網(wǎng)頁的打開速度,直接影響用戶體驗。

在優(yōu)化的過程中要盡量減少javascript代碼的運用,對必須要使用的javascript,也要盡量放到網(wǎng)站的底部先加載正文,或外部js調(diào)用(封裝)。

為什么要放在底部呢?

可能你不懂代碼就不知道了,這里來解釋一下,因為瀏覽器在渲染頁面時(也就是展現(xiàn)頁面)會從上到下渲染。

我們的模版,JS絕對都是放在頭部,但在優(yōu)化的過程中,而JS文件通常是效果文件,我們可以讓網(wǎng)站先加載主題內(nèi)容,其次加載效果內(nèi)容,所以有必要把JS文件從頭部移動到底部,這樣用戶看起來你的網(wǎng)站會訪問的更快,當(dāng)然如果CSS有必要,一樣可以這樣做,常規(guī)的CSS是不建議放到底部,會影響加載效果。另外JS及CSS不建議在html模版中寫入,最好是新建一個JS或CSS文件,然后把JS或CSS內(nèi)容放入,在調(diào)用這個CSS或JS文件即可。

四、清理垃圾代碼

清理垃圾代碼是精簡代碼其中一個非常重要的環(huán)節(jié)。垃圾代碼是刪除后不會影響頁面顯示的非必要的代碼,一個頁面在清理了垃圾代碼后,可以刪除近80%的冗余代碼。從而達(dá)到降低頁面體積,提高頁面的用戶體驗和搜索引擎友好性的目的。常見的垃圾代碼有 空格字符、默認(rèn)屬性、注釋語句、和空語句等。

1、空格字符

空格字符實在編輯代碼時敲擊鍵盤上的空格鍵而產(chǎn)生的符號,網(wǎng)頁中每一個空格都算作一個字符,通常出現(xiàn)在每行代碼的開始處、結(jié)尾處以及空行中。

2、默認(rèn)屬性

我們在使用網(wǎng)頁制作軟件時,都會產(chǎn)生一些默認(rèn)屬性的代碼,比如我們在網(wǎng)頁中不添加左對齊的屬性,但是頁面中的內(nèi)容也是左對齊的,所以代碼中的左對齊屬性代碼就可以刪除。

3、注釋語句

在制作網(wǎng)頁的時候,我們會添加一些注釋語句來增強代碼的可讀性,但是過多的注釋語句會占用大量的網(wǎng)頁空間,而且如果注釋語句中存在大量的關(guān)鍵詞,還會被搜索引擎認(rèn)為是堆砌關(guān)鍵詞,從而對該站進(jìn)行處罰。所以我們在添加注釋語句時,就盡量避免添加那些即使刪除后也不會影響網(wǎng)頁源代碼可讀性的注釋語句。

4、空語句

空語句是指標(biāo)簽之間不存在任何內(nèi)容的空句子。

五、LOGO:

LOGO部分需要優(yōu)化的主要有兩個方面,第一個方面在LOGO處加H1標(biāo)簽,其次是在LOGO的A標(biāo)簽處添加一個title屬性,title屬性中寫上你優(yōu)化的主關(guān)鍵詞,之所以建議寫主關(guān)鍵詞而不寫品牌詞原因有兩個,第一個增加優(yōu)化主關(guān)鍵詞的密度,其次是title屬性用戶很難得看得到。

六、導(dǎo)航:

導(dǎo)航上的優(yōu)化,通常就是一個A標(biāo)簽,這個A標(biāo)簽不建議設(shè)置新窗口打開,另外一個是A標(biāo)簽中的title屬性,如果條件允許,可以直接設(shè)置成行業(yè)詞,而A標(biāo)簽中可顯示的文字可以設(shè)置成品牌詞,這樣在不影響體驗的同時一樣達(dá)到了優(yōu)化關(guān)鍵詞的效果。

這里需要提醒一點的是,當(dāng)一篇文章出現(xiàn)兩個一樣的A標(biāo)簽指向的時候,我們需要用nofollow標(biāo)簽屏蔽其中一個鏈接,這里描述和標(biāo)題都出現(xiàn)了同一個鏈接,這里建議使用nofollow標(biāo)簽屏蔽描述上的鏈接,加上去是為了讓用戶方便點擊,屏蔽是為了不讓搜索引擎重復(fù)抓取。

七、搜索:

站內(nèi)搜索頁面本不建議做SEO優(yōu)化,因為大多站內(nèi)搜索都是動態(tài)頁面,而這些動態(tài)頁面均直接用robots屏蔽百度蜘蛛。

八、圖片優(yōu)化

1、名稱

由于搜索引擎無法讀取圖片內(nèi)容,但是可以讀取圖片名稱的相關(guān)文本信息,所以我們在保存圖片名稱時,要確保圖片文件名或字符串包含主要關(guān)鍵詞。例如一張熊貓的圖片,我們可以隨意命名,但是我們最好將其命名為xiongmao.jpg 或者 panda.jpg 這樣URL字符串就包含了這張圖的關(guān)鍵信息。

2、ALT標(biāo)簽

圖片中的信息要想讓搜索引擎更好的理解,必須利用alt屬性,圖片的alt屬性是對圖片信息進(jìn)行簡要闡述。alt屬性非常重要,必須做到與圖片相關(guān),與內(nèi)容相關(guān),且需要避免為了關(guān)鍵詞堆砌而堆砌,該屬性不僅能夠讓搜索引擎更好的理解,同時若圖片出現(xiàn)錯誤時,也能夠讓用戶了解圖片想要展示的主題。

網(wǎng)站優(yōu)化從根本上來說,是為了用戶更好的獲取信息,而不是搜索引擎中獲得良好的排名,取得好的搜索結(jié)果排名只是正常網(wǎng)站優(yōu)化結(jié)果的自然體現(xiàn)。所以在設(shè)置描述 alt這些屬性時,應(yīng)該本著遵循用戶導(dǎo)向的原則,簡明扼要地描述圖片內(nèi)容。

3、大小

如果網(wǎng)站不是專業(yè)的圖片展示,網(wǎng)站只要滿足普通視覺效果就可以了,圖片越小加載起來就越快。

九、版權(quán):

版權(quán)是可以留下的,使用別人的程序不留版權(quán)是不道德的行為,所以有必要在底部留下對于的版權(quán)信息,但是版權(quán)、備案、站外鏈接都應(yīng)該加nofollow標(biāo)簽,當(dāng)然這是站外的鏈接,站內(nèi)也有部分鏈接需要加入nofollow標(biāo)簽,比如網(wǎng)站底部的廣告合作、聯(lián)系方式等頁面。

十、體驗:

其實在用戶體驗上的優(yōu)化本問說的并不少很多,但代碼可以決定用戶體驗,比如增加百度統(tǒng)計的返回頂部功能,文章頁面增加快速評論功能、一個網(wǎng)站最多只能顯示3屏、左右可以翻頁等功能,看起來功能非常少,但綜合的細(xì)節(jié)決定一個網(wǎng)站的成敗!

十一、網(wǎng)站地圖:

網(wǎng)站地圖是搜索引擎最容易抓取的一個頁面,這個頁面里面有所有應(yīng)該被抓取的內(nèi)容,所以很多時候,搜索引擎為了偷懶,他自然會抓取網(wǎng)站地圖文件,通常情況下網(wǎng)站地圖的代碼如下所示:

<url>

<loc>http://www.xxxxx.com/</loc>

<priority>1.0</priority>

<lastmod>2018-05-08T07:01:31+00:00</lastmod>

<changefreq>Always</changefreq>

</url>

代碼非常簡單LOC為鏈接、priority為權(quán)重,比如首頁為1,欄目為0.8,changefreq為更新時間。

網(wǎng)站前端SEO代碼及標(biāo)簽的優(yōu)化

12、Robots:

搜索引擎在抓取一個網(wǎng)站的時候,第一時間看robots 文件,這里可以識別到哪些文件可以抓取,哪些文件不可以,robots文件最主要一點就是把網(wǎng)站地圖寫上去,如下所示:

Sitemap:http://www.xxxxx.com/sitemap.xml

最后題外話,雖然我不完全相信二八定律,但二八定律絕對是真實存在的。

大的不講,放在SEO這行里,可以總結(jié)為以下幾條:

1、80%的人從來沒自己實戰(zhàn)過網(wǎng)上的說法!

2、80%的網(wǎng)絡(luò)公司都沒有自己核心的技術(shù)!

3、80%的SEO從業(yè)人員水平都很一般!

其實跳出SEO這個圈子,放到其他行業(yè),也是一樣的,其他行業(yè)里的一些道理,放在SEO里,也同樣適用。

網(wǎng)頁題目:網(wǎng)站前端SEO代碼及標(biāo)簽的優(yōu)化
文章源于:http://www.muchs.cn/article47/dghsphj.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供搜索引擎優(yōu)化、面包屑導(dǎo)航、定制開發(fā)域名注冊、企業(yè)網(wǎng)站制作

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

成都網(wǎng)站建設(shè)